How Do Finance Teams Implement Reporting And Analytics In Payment Methods For Multi-Currency Reconciliation?

Reconciling ledgers across multiple currencies involves distinct technical challenges, primarily due to timing differences, fluctuating exchange rates, and asymmetric data structures provided by different banking institutions. Finance teams implement Reporting And Analytics In Payment Methods by integrating automated treasury management systems with global banking APIs to achieve straight-through processing. When a corporate buyer initiates an overseas settlement, the transmitted data frequently degrades as it passes through various intermediary clearing houses. By utilizing advanced analytical frameworks, organizations can capture the original SWIFT MT103 messaging data alongside newer ISO 20022 extended XML formats, ensuring that crucial remittance information remains intact from the point of origin to the final beneficiary account.

Implementing these systems requires a deliberate structural alignment between the merchant's internal accounting software and their external financial gateways. Organizations typically configure webhook notifications to capture real-time status updates on inbound funds. This raw data is then channeled into a centralized data warehouse where analytics engines parse the information, standardizing date formats, currency codes, and transaction references. The resulting normalized dataset enables automated matching algorithms to pair incoming deposits with specific ledger entries based on weighted probabilistic matching criteria, rather than relying solely on exact alphanumeric string matches which often fail due to truncated banking references.

Furthermore, managing multi-currency environments demands rigorous tracking of realized and unrealized foreign exchange gains or losses. Analytical reporting systems isolate the baseline currency value from the applied conversion rate at the exact moment of execution. This separation of variables provides financial controllers with clear visibility into the mechanical cost of currency conversion versus the actual underlying value of the traded goods. Consequently, month-end closing procedures that previously required weeks of manual verification can be compressed into a matter of days, freeing up human capital for strategic financial planning rather than repetitive administrative validation.

Key Data Points Required for Accurate Ledger Matching

Achieving automated ledger synchronization depends entirely on the quality and granularity of the captured data. A robust reporting infrastructure must consistently extract specific metadata fields from every transaction. The primary identifier is the unique end-to-end reference assigned at the time of initiation, which serves as the digital anchor connecting the physical transfer of funds to the digital invoice. Alongside this identifier, systems must capture the precise timestamp of initiation, the timestamp of network clearing, and the final timestamp of account crediting. Analyzing the deltas between these timestamps allows operational teams to measure network latency and evaluate the efficiency of chosen routing paths.

Beyond temporal data, financial analytics must evaluate the exact quantitative figures involved in the transfer. This includes the gross amount dispatched by the remitter, the explicit fee deductions taken by intermediary institutions, the applied interbank exchange rate, the specific institutional markup applied to that rate, and the final net amount credited to the beneficiary. Without disaggregating these numerical values, accounting departments cannot accurately balance their general ledgers, leading to accumulating discrepancies in revenue reporting. Granular analytical tools automatically categorize these deductions into appropriate expense accounts, ensuring tax compliance and accurate profit margin calculations for individual international shipments.

Entity-specific metadata is equally critical. Systems must parse the legal name of the originating entity, their registered operational address, and their institutional routing numbers. In B2B environments where parent companies pay on behalf of regional subsidiaries, mapping the payer entity data against the registered client database prevents orphaned payments—funds that sit in suspense accounts because the receiving organization cannot identify the intended invoice. Advanced matching algorithms use historical payment behavior analytics to suggest ledger correlations, effectively learning from past manual interventions to continuously improve the automated straight-through processing rate.

What Are The Common Cost Structures Uncovered By Continuous Transaction Tracking?

International corporate settlements are notoriously plagued by opaque fee structures that erode profit margins. Continuous tracking mechanisms systematically unmask these hidden expenses, providing procurement and finance teams with the empirical evidence needed to negotiate better terms or select alternative routing networks. The baseline cost of moving capital typically consists of fixed wire fees imposed by the originating institution. However, analytical tools frequently reveal that these upfront charges represent merely a fraction of the total execution cost. Correspondent banking networks operate on instruction codes—such as OUR, BEN, or SHA—which dictate entity liability for intermediary deductions. Without systematic reporting, businesses often absorb unexpected deductions when intermediary nodes extract their handling fees directly from the principal transfer amount.

Foreign exchange markups constitute another massive, yet frequently obscured, cost center in global trade. Banks and financial gateways often provide a blended exchange rate that bundles the real-time interbank market rate with an undisclosed institutional spread. Reporting tools capable of querying live market rates at the exact millisecond of a transaction's execution can isolate this spread, quantifying the exact margin captured by the financial provider. Aggregating this data over a fiscal quarter reveals the macro-level financial impact of these markups, empowering Chief Financial Officers to mandate routing adjustments, such as holding multi-currency balances or utilizing specialized foreign exchange derivative instruments to hedge against systematic margin erosion.

Additionally, transaction failure and investigation costs represent a significant operational burden. When a transfer is flagged for manual review, returned due to formatting errors, or suspended for compliance checks, businesses incur direct amendment fees alongside the indirect cost of delayed supply chain operations. Analytics dashboards highlight the specific error codes and geographic corridors most prone to these failures. By identifying patterns in formatting rejections, treasury teams can update their localized payment templates, ensuring that mandatory field requirements—such as purpose of payment codes required by certain Asian or South American jurisdictions—are systematically populated prior to initiation.

How Can Global Traders Accelerate Settlement Speeds While Maintaining Compliance?

The velocity of cross-border capital directly dictates the efficiency of global supply chains. When manufacturers wait weeks for funds to clear international banking networks, production schedules stall, and inventory carrying costs escalate. Accelerating these settlement speeds requires a fundamental shift from sequential, manual compliance processing to concurrent, data-driven validation. Reporting systems continuously monitor inbound and outbound flows, pre-validating transaction parameters against global sanction lists and historical trade patterns. By enriching the payment instruction with comprehensive commercial metadata at the point of origin, businesses can bypass manual administrative holds at intermediary institutions, enabling straight-through processing even across highly regulated jurisdictions.

Maintaining stringent compliance while increasing velocity necessitates infrastructure that inherently understands the complexities of international trade rules. Institutions must route funds through networks designed to handle heavy compliance burdens algorithmically rather than manually. Speed is further enhanced by utilizing regional clearing systems whenever possible, rather than defaulting to the global SWIFT network for every transaction. Analytics platforms evaluate the beneficiary's location and automatically select the most efficient domestic rail—such as SEPA in Europe or ACH-equivalent systems in Asia. This intelligent routing requires constant monitoring of network uptimes, cutoff schedules, and local holiday calendars. A comprehensive reporting dashboard visualizes these routing decisions in real-time, providing controllers with actionable intelligence regarding why a specific settlement methodology was executed, proving invaluable during subsequent internal audits or regulatory inquiries.

Utilizing Transaction Metadata to Streamline KYC and AML Processes

Know Your Customer (KYC) and Anti-Money Laundering (AML) regulations require comprehensive documentation and continuous monitoring of corporate behavior. Traditionally, compliance officers reactively requested invoices, bills of lading, and customs declarations whenever a transaction triggered an arbitrary financial threshold. Modern reporting methodologies flip this paradigm by proactively embedding commercial context into the data stream. By automatically linking digital trade documents to the specific transaction ID via API integrations, compliance teams gain immediate access to the entire economic rationale of the transfer, drastically reducing the time required to clear anomalous flags.

Furthermore, analytical algorithms construct dynamic behavioral profiles for every trading partner. Instead of relying on static risk scores assigned during initial onboarding, the system continuously recalculates risk exposure based on transactional frequency, volume variance, and geographic routing changes. If a long-standing supplier in Vietnam suddenly requests a change of beneficiary account to a different jurisdiction, the analytical engine immediately elevates the risk profile, suspending the specific settlement for human review while allowing standard pattern transactions to process unimpeded. This targeted application of friction ensures that security measures do not broadly degrade overall liquidity velocity.

Regulatory reporting also transitions from a burdensome quarterly project to an automated daily output. Authorities increasingly demand granular data regarding cross-border capital flight and corporate tax liabilities. Well-structured analytical databases can automatically generate the required XML files formatted to specific governmental standards, ensuring that the enterprise remains in good standing across all operational jurisdictions. The ability to instantly produce auditable, mathematically verified data trails protects the business from steep regulatory fines and the severe reputational damage associated with compliance failures.

How Does Granular Transaction Data Mitigate Fraud and Execution Risks in Cross-Border Trade?

The landscape of international corporate trade is continually targeted by sophisticated fraud syndicates utilizing business email compromise (BEC), invoice manipulation, and synthetic identity tactics. Defending against these vectors requires more than standard firewall configurations; it demands deep, continuous analysis of the financial data itself. Granular transaction reporting acts as an operational radar, scanning for micro-anomalies that human operators inevitably miss. When millions of dollars flow across borders daily, a manipulated routing number or a subtle change in the recipient's corporate registration data can result in irrecoverable capital loss. Analytical engines cross-reference outgoing instructions against historically verified master data, instantly blocking execution if the parameters deviate beyond established tolerance levels.

Execution risk, while less malicious than direct fraud, poses an equally significant threat to enterprise stability. This occurs when instructions are formatted incorrectly, leading to funds being locked in suspense accounts or returned after prolonged delays, minus substantial administrative fees. Advanced analytical platforms scrutinize the formatting of instructions before they are released to the clearing network. They verify the mathematical validity of IBAN structures, cross-reference SWIFT BIC codes against live registry databases, and ensure that mandatory compliance fields are adequately populated. By catching formatting errors internally, businesses avoid external penalty fees and maintain robust supplier relationships by ensuring reliable, on-time settlements.

Predictive analytics also play a crucial role in mitigating macroeconomic execution risks, such as sudden currency devaluations or geopolitical sanctions. By mapping the entire network of tier-one and tier-two suppliers against real-time global news feeds and currency volatility indices, finance teams receive early warning alerts regarding potential liquidity bottlenecks. If analytical reporting highlights heavy reliance on a supplier situated in a newly sanctioned region or a country experiencing rapid inflation, the treasury department can proactively reroute purchasing orders or execute forward currency contracts, insulating the enterprise from external systemic shocks.

Defining Key Risk Indicators (KRIs) for International B2B Collections

Establishing a robust defensive posture requires the explicit definition of Key Risk Indicators (KRIs) tailored specifically to the nuances of B2B collections and disbursements. A primary KRI is the 'Velocity of Entity Data Changes'. If a vendor profile exhibits multiple updates to banking details, contact personnel, or registered addresses within a compressed timeframe, the analytics platform must categorize this as high risk. Such rapid modifications frequently indicate corporate account takeover attempts. Tracking the temporal frequency of these changes provides a mathematical basis for freezing automated disbursements until manual verification is secured via independent communication channels.

Another critical KRI revolves around 'Volume and Value Discrepancies'. Analytical models establish baselines for typical order volumes and seasonal fluctuations associated with specific buyers. If an incoming collection significantly exceeds historical maximums, or conversely, if a series of micro-payments replaces standard bulk settlements, the system flags these as structural anomalies. Micro-payments might indicate attempts to structure transactions below regulatory reporting thresholds, a classic AML red flag. Monitoring the standard deviation of transaction values ensures that compliance officers focus their limited attention solely on statistically significant outliers.

Geographic routing incongruities represent a third vital KRI. In standard trade scenarios, the location of the buyer, the destination of the physical goods, and the origin of the financial settlement generally align logically. When reporting systems detect triangulation anomalies—such as a buyer registered in Europe, receiving goods in North America, but funding the transaction from a shell account in a known offshore tax haven—the system automatically triggers enhanced due diligence protocols. The correlation of logistics data with financial settlement data provides an impenetrable layer of contextual security, ensuring that the enterprise does not inadvertently facilitate illicit capital movements.

How Should CFOs Structure Reporting And Analytics In Payment Methods To Improve Working Capital?

For Chief Financial Officers, the ultimate objective of tracking financial mechanics is the optimization of the cash conversion cycle. Structuring Reporting And Analytics In Payment Methods requires breaking down legacy data silos that traditionally separate procurement, sales, and treasury departments. A modernized architecture centralizes all inflow and outflow data, providing a singular, unvarnished view of corporate liquidity. By analyzing the exact clearing times of various settlement networks, CFOs can precision-time their accounts payable executions, holding onto cash for the maximum allowable duration without breaching supplier contract terms. This strategic delay in disbursements, coupled with accelerated collection rails, mechanically expands the pool of available working capital.

Furthermore, structural optimization demands that analytics directly influence procurement strategies. When the data reveals that settling invoices in local currencies via regional rails is significantly cheaper than forcing suppliers to accept major reserve currencies via global wire transfers, CFOs can mandate shifts in contract negotiations. Offering suppliers payment in their domestic currency often secures early-settlement discounts, as it removes the FX risk from their books. The corporate entity, armed with institutional-grade foreign exchange infrastructure, can absorb and manage that currency conversion far more efficiently than the individual supplier.
